While we wait for the return of normalcy, I recommend viewing a fascinating video about the origins of Silicon Valley called,
"The Secret History of Silicon Valley".
The video is an engaging presentation that starts with the development of radar during World War II and the Allies'
strategies for bombing Germany and the German's extensive radar network used for guiding their anti-aircraft weaponry. The presentation continues with information
about how Silicon Valley technology was used to protect B-52's and A-12's from Soviet radar during the Cold War (Did you know "The Dish" in the hills west of
Stanford was originally funded by the CIA and NSA for detecting Soviet radar waves that bounced off the moon?), Lockheed building missiles and satellites in Sunnyvale, and a lot more.
